Application information
1. MUTE Function
When the mute pin is low(GND), the TR Q1 is turned on and the bias
circuit is enabled. On the other hand, when the mute pin is high , the TR
Q1 is turned off and the bias circuit is disabled.
It will make all the circuit blocks except CH1 off, so low power quies-
cent state can be established.

3. Notice
• If REF(pin23) is lower than 0.7V, BTL output is off.
• Under voltage protecton function. ( If SVcc is lower than 3.8V, Chip is disable. Hysterisis is 0.2V)
• Mute on BTL output voltage is as followed:
• Each output to output and output to GND short should be kept away.
